欧美阿v视频在线大全_亚洲欧美中文日韩V在线观看_www性欧美日韩欧美91_亚洲欧美日韩久久精品

主頁 > 知識庫 > Python操作CSV格式文件的方法大全

Python操作CSV格式文件的方法大全

熱門標簽:外賣地址有什么地圖標注 煙臺電話外呼營銷系統 長春極信防封電銷卡批發 電銷機器人錄音要學習什么 預覽式外呼系統 上海正規的外呼系統最新報價 企業彩鈴地圖標注 銀川電話機器人電話 如何地圖標注公司

(一)CSV格式文件

1.說明

CSV是一種以逗號分隔數值的文件類型,在數據庫或電子表格中,常見的導入導出文件格式就是CSV格式,CSV格式存儲數據通常以純文本的方式存數數據表。

(二)CSV庫操作csv格式文本

操作一下表格數據:

1.讀取表頭的2中方式

#方式一
import csv
with open("D:\\test.csv") as f:
    reader = csv.reader(f)
    rows=[row for row in  reader]
    print(rows[0])


----------
#方式二
import csv
with open("D:\\test.csv") as f:
    #1.創建閱讀器對象
    reader = csv.reader(f)
    #2.讀取文件第一行數據
    head_row=next(reader)
    print(head_row)

結果演示:['姓名', '年齡', '職業', '家庭地址', '工資']

2.讀取文件某一列數據

#1.獲取文件某一列數據
import csv
with open("D:\\test.csv") as f:
    reader = csv.reader(f)
    column=[row[0] for row in  reader]
    print(column)

結果演示:['姓名', '張三', '李四', '王五', 'Kaina']

3.向csv文件中寫入數據

#1.向csv文件中寫入數據
import csv
with open("D:\\test.csv",'a') as f:
     row=['曹操','23','學生','黑龍江','5000']
     write=csv.writer(f)
     write.writerow(row)
     print("寫入完畢!")

結果演示:

4.獲取文件頭及其索引

import csv
with open("D:\\test.csv") as f:
    #1.創建閱讀器對象
    reader = csv.reader(f)
    #2.讀取文件第一行數據
    head_row=next(reader)
    print(head_row)
    #4.獲取文件頭及其索引
    for index,column_header in enumerate(head_row):
        print(index,column_header)

結果演示:
['姓名', '年齡', '職業', '家庭地址', '工資']
0 姓名
1 年齡
2 職業
3 家庭地址
4 工資

5.獲取某列的最大值

# ['姓名', '年齡', '職業', '家庭地址', '工資']
import csv
with open("D:\\test.csv") as f:
    reader = csv.reader(f)
    header_row=next(reader)
    # print(header_row)
    salary=[]
    for row in reader:
        #把第五列數據保存到列表salary中
         salary.append(int(row[4]))
    print(salary)
    print("員工最高工資為:"+str(max(salary)))

結果演示:員工最高工資為:10000

6.復制CSV格式文件

原文件test.csv

import csv
f=open('test.csv')
#1.newline=''消除空格行
aim_file=open('Aim.csv','w',newline='')
write=csv.writer(aim_file)
reader=csv.reader(f)
rows=[row for row in reader]
#2.遍歷rows列表
for row in rows:
    #3.把每一行寫到Aim.csv中
    write.writerow(row)

01.未添加關鍵字參數newline=' '的結果:

02添加關鍵字參數newline=' '的Aim.csv文件的內容:

(三)pandas庫操作CSV文件

csv文件內容:

1.安裝pandas庫:pip install pandas

2.讀取csv文件所有數據

 import pandas as pd
path= 'D:\\test.csv'
with open(path)as file:
    data=pd.read_csv(file)
    print(data)

結果演示:
      姓名  年齡   職業  家庭地址     工資
0     張三  22   廚師   北京市   6000
1     李四  26  攝影師  湖南長沙   8000
2     王五  28  程序員    深圳  10000
3  Kaina  22   學生   黑龍江   2000
4     曹操  28   銷售    上海   6000

3.describe()方法數據統計

import pandas as pd
path= 'D:\\test.csv'
with open(path)as file:
    data=pd.read_csv(file)
    #了解更多describe()知識,ctr+鼠標左鍵
    print(data.describe())

結果演示:
             年齡            工資
count   5.00000      5.000000
mean   25.20000   6400.000000
std     3.03315   2966.479395
min    22.00000   2000.000000
25%    22.00000   6000.000000
50%    26.00000   6000.000000
75%    28.00000   8000.000000
max    28.00000  10000.000000

4.讀取文件前幾行數據

import pandas as pd
path= 'D:\\test.csv'
with open(path)as file:
    data=pd.read_csv(file)
    #讀取前2行數據
    # head_datas = data.head(0)
    head_datas=data.head(2)
    print(head_datas)


結果演示:
   姓名  年齡   職業  家庭地址    工資
0  張三  22   廚師   北京市  6000
1  李四  26  攝影師  湖南長沙  8000

5.讀取某一行所有數據

import pandas as pd
path= 'D:\\test.csv'
with open(path)as file:
    data=pd.read_csv(file)
    #讀取第一行所有數據
    print(data.ix[0,])


結果演示:
姓名        張三
年齡        22
職業        廚師
家庭地址     北京市
工資      6000

6.讀取某幾行的數據

import pandas as pd
path= 'D:\\test.csv'
with open(path)as file:
    data=pd.read_csv(file)
    #讀取第一行、第二行、第四行的所有數據
    print(data.ix[[0,1,3],:])


結果演示:
      姓名  年齡   職業  家庭地址    工資
0     張三  22   廚師   北京市  6000
1     李四  26  攝影師  湖南長沙  8000
3  Kaina  22   學生   黑龍江  2000

7.讀取所有行和列數據

import pandas as pd
path= 'D:\\test.csv'
with open(path)as file:
    data=pd.read_csv(file)
    #讀取所有行和列數據
    print(data.ix[:,:])

結果演示:
      姓名  年齡   職業  家庭地址     工資
0     張三  22   廚師   北京市   6000
1     李四  26  攝影師  湖南長沙   8000
2     王五  28  程序員    深圳  10000
3  Kaina  22   學生   黑龍江   2000
4     曹操  28   銷售    上海   6000

8.讀取某一列的所有行數據

import pandas as pd
path= 'D:\\test.csv'
with open(path)as file:
    data=pd.read_csv(file)
    # print(data.ix[:, 4])
    print(data.ix[:,'工資'])

結果演示:
0     6000
1     8000
2    10000
3     2000
4     6000
Name: 工資, dtype: int64

9.讀取某幾列的某幾行

import pandas as pd
path= 'D:\\test.csv'
with open(path)as file:
    data=pd.read_csv(file)
    print(data.ix[[0,1,3],['姓名','職業','工資']])

結果演示:
      姓名   職業    工資
0     張三   廚師  6000
1     李四  攝影師  8000
3  Kaina   學生  2000

10.讀取某一行和某一列對應的數據

import pandas as pd
path= 'D:\\test.csv'
with open(path)as file:
    data=pd.read_csv(file)
    #讀取第三行的第三列
    print("職業---"+data.ix[2,2])

結果演示:職業---程序員

11.CSV數據的導入導出(復制CSV文件)

讀方式01:

import pandas as pd
#1.讀入數據
data=pd.read_csv(file)

寫出數據02:

import pandas as pd
#1.寫出數據,目標文件是Aim.csv
data.to_csv('Aim.csv')

其他:

01.讀取網絡數據:
import pandas as pd 
data_url = "https://raw.githubusercontent.com/mwaskom/seaborn-data/master/tips.csv"
#填寫url讀取
df = pd.read_csv(data_url)


----------
02.讀取excel文件數據
import pandas as pd 
data = pd.read_excel(filepath)

實例演示:

1.test.csv原文件內容

2.現在把test.csv中的內容復制到Aim.csv中

import pandas as pd
file=open('test.csv')
#1.讀取file中的數據
data=pd.read_csv(file)
#2.把data寫到目標文件Aim.csv中
data.to_csv('Aim.csv')
print(data)

結果演示:

注:pandas模塊處理Excel文件和處理CSV文件差不多!

參考文檔:https://docs.python.org/3.6/library/csv.html

總結

到此這篇關于Python操作CSV格式文件的文章就介紹到這了,更多相關Python操作CSV文件內容請搜索腳本之家以前的文章或繼續瀏覽下面的相關文章希望大家以后多多支持腳本之家!

您可能感興趣的文章:
  • Python寫入CSV文件的方法
  • Python將列表數據寫入文件(txt, csv,excel)
  • python對csv文件追加寫入列的方法
  • python讀寫csv文件方法詳細總結
  • python讀取csv文件示例(python操作csv)
  • python寫入數據到csv或xlsx文件的3種方法
  • 利用Python如何將數據寫到CSV文件中
  • Python使用pandas處理CSV文件的實例講解
  • Python操作csv文件實例詳解
  • Python實現讀取及寫入csv文件的方法示例

標簽:潮州 宜昌 上饒 湖北 西寧 珠海 盤錦 佳木斯

巨人網絡通訊聲明:本文標題《Python操作CSV格式文件的方法大全》,本文關鍵詞  Python,操作,CSV,格式,文件,;如發現本文內容存在版權問題,煩請提供相關信息告之我們,我們將及時溝通與處理。本站內容系統采集于網絡,涉及言論、版權與本站無關。
  • 相關文章
  • 下面列出與本文章《Python操作CSV格式文件的方法大全》相關的同類信息!
  • 本頁收集關于Python操作CSV格式文件的方法大全的相關信息資訊供網民參考!
  • 推薦文章
    欧美阿v视频在线大全_亚洲欧美中文日韩V在线观看_www性欧美日韩欧美91_亚洲欧美日韩久久精品
  • <rt id="w000q"><acronym id="w000q"></acronym></rt>
  • <abbr id="w000q"></abbr>
    <rt id="w000q"></rt>
    99久久久国产精品免费蜜臀| 久久久久国产精品区片区无码| 欧美人与禽zoz0善交| 欧美一区二区在线播放| 一区二区免费视频| 成人a级免费电影| 熟女少妇a性色生活片毛片| 久久一二三国产| 精品亚洲国内自在自线福利| 国产一二三四五区| 精品国产91亚洲一区二区三区婷婷 | 美腿丝袜亚洲色图| 黄色录像a级片| 欧美日韩国产综合一区二区| 天天操夜夜操av| 久久久国产精华| 国内精品久久久久影院薰衣草 | www.com日本| 欧美日韩中文国产| 亚洲福利视频三区| v天堂中文在线| 日韩精品一区二| 久久99国内精品| 亚洲一二三精品| 欧美国产精品专区| 成人午夜视频免费看| 色悠久久久久综合欧美99| 亚洲日本在线a| 欧美熟妇精品一区二区| 69堂成人精品免费视频| 日韩av一区二区三区四区| 免费污网站在线观看| 久久久精品影视| 成人综合婷婷国产精品久久免费| 色哟哟日韩精品| 亚洲一本大道在线| 奇米色一区二区| 阿v天堂2014| 国产精品久久久久一区二区三区 | 国内精品免费**视频| 国产精品国产三级国产传播| 亚洲欧洲精品一区二区精品久久久 | 欧美国产精品v| 99久免费精品视频在线观看| 欧美日韩www| 麻豆91免费看| 紧身裙女教师波多野结衣| 夜夜揉揉日日人人青青一国产精品 | 无码人妻久久一区二区三区蜜桃| 欧美一区在线视频| 国产精品自在在线| 欧美性大战久久久久久久蜜臀| 亚洲高清在线视频| 国产123在线| 一区二区三区在线观看国产| 法国伦理少妇愉情| 最新国产成人在线观看| 亚洲av成人精品一区二区三区| 久久婷婷综合激情| 精品人妻一区二区三| 日韩精品一区二区三区在线| 成人av影视在线观看| 欧美高清精品3d| 国产成人在线视频网站| 人人爽人人爽人人片| 亚洲同性gay激情无套| 欧美 日本 国产| 成人欧美一区二区三区| 香港三日本8a三级少妇三级99| 国产精品私人影院| 完美搭档在线观看| 中文字幕在线观看不卡视频| 国产麻豆剧传媒精品国产av| 国产精品理论片在线观看| 手机在线看片日韩| 亚洲日本青草视频在线怡红院 | 久久综合久久综合亚洲| 欧美高清精品一区二区| 国产区在线观看成人精品 | 日韩欧美视频免费观看| 天天影视色香欲综合网老头| 欧美做爰爽爽爽爽爽爽| 蜜桃av一区二区在线观看| 欧美影视一区在线| 国产精品一区二区x88av| 在线综合视频播放| av综合在线播放| 久久久99精品久久| 在线视频 日韩| 亚洲精品福利视频网站| 在线免费看视频| 视频在线观看一区二区三区| 在线中文字幕一区二区| 国产激情精品久久久第一区二区 | 免费观看av网站| 亚洲成人一区在线| 一本大道久久a久久精二百| 国产综合色产在线精品| 欧美一区二区精品在线| 男人的天堂免费| 亚洲三级免费电影| 日本一级片免费| 国内精品视频666| 亚洲精品一区二区三区福利| 国产婷婷在线观看| 亚洲一线二线三线久久久| wwwav国产| 国产成人精品综合在线观看 | 日本人添下边视频免费| 亚洲欧洲www| 欧美风情第一页| 国产美女精品人人做人人爽| 欧美成人精品福利| 亚洲精品乱码久久久久久不卡| 亚洲午夜在线观看视频在线| 91精品福利视频| 99精品视频一区| 亚洲丝袜制服诱惑| wwwav国产| 成人av在线一区二区三区| 亚洲欧洲日韩在线| 亚洲综合网在线| 粉嫩aⅴ一区二区三区四区| 欧美国产激情一区二区三区蜜月 | 国产精品盗摄一区二区三区| 国产精品视频看看| 国产传媒久久文化传媒| 国产欧美精品一区aⅴ影院 | 97人妻人人揉人人躁人人| 青青青伊人色综合久久| 欧美一级视频精品观看| 成人h动漫精品一区| 久久电影网电视剧免费观看| 精品国产乱码久久久久久老虎| 新91视频在线观看| 久久99久久99精品免视看婷婷| 欧美精品一区在线观看| wwwww黄色| 国产成人av在线影院| 国产精品美女久久久久av爽李琼| 国产精品白丝喷水在线观看| 99国内精品久久| 亚洲自拍偷拍图区| 69av一区二区三区| 精品无码一区二区三区| 久久国产三级精品| 日本一区二区三区免费乱视频| 天天看天天摸天天操| 成人激情小说网站| 一区二区三区中文字幕精品精品| 欧美日韩精品欧美日韩精品一| 亚洲色偷偷色噜噜狠狠99网 | 天天av天天翘天天综合网| 欧美一区在线视频| 2019男人天堂| 成人免费观看视频| 亚洲最大成人网4388xx| 欧美一区二区三区免费视频 | 天天av天天翘天天综合网| 欧美变态tickling挠脚心| 亚洲色图日韩精品| 北条麻妃国产九九精品视频| 亚洲午夜在线视频| 久久综合999| 国产探花在线播放| 欧美久久久久久久久久久| 麻豆传媒一区二区三区| 国产精品嫩草影院av蜜臀| 欧美性色黄大片手机版| 欧美黑人欧美精品刺激| 国产成人精品亚洲午夜麻豆| 亚洲精品精品亚洲| 欧美电视剧免费全集观看| 免费高清在线观看电视| 影音先锋资源av| 国产一二精品视频| 亚洲永久精品国产| 久久久激情视频| 欧美日韩在线免费视频| 男人天堂av电影| 99精品国产一区二区三区不卡 | 欧洲一区二区av| www.色天使| 99热国产精品| 美国精品在线观看| 亚洲日本在线观看| 久久在线观看免费| 色天天综合久久久久综合片| 久久久无码人妻精品一区| 成人黄色在线视频| 青青草91视频| 亚洲日韩欧美一区二区在线| 精品国产乱码久久久久久老虎 | 久久久久久久综合日本| 欧美午夜电影网| 精品在线观看一区| 中文文字幕文字幕高清| 99麻豆久久久国产精品免费 | 亚洲欧美自拍偷拍| 精品国产一区二区三区忘忧草 |